Output 20659a5efb686b7bf37e9e856ed72a15f297f55502b054c120b4b6381fab7ae1:0

value
11239
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71820331f0c145e96014204994d32673c73c3aea OP_EQUAL
address
3C3C2eRouNraNNADJVNYmjoX1gR6bjLda1
transaction
20659a5efb686b7bf37e9e856ed72a15f297f55502b054c120b4b6381fab7ae1
confirmations
199554
spent
true